InWin’s Aeon: The Futuristic Egg-Shaped PC Case with a Dramatic Hydraulic Opening

As CES 2026 captivated tech enthusiasts with a glimpse into future innovations, one creation from InWin truly encapsulated the spirit of bold design: the InWin Aeon PC case. Unveiled as InWin’s 12th ‘Signature Chassis’, this full tower marvel instantly distinguishes itself with a striking resemblance to a futuristic glass egg, adorned with mosaic mirrored panels. Its substantial presence—measuring 840 mm by 691 mm with a towering height of 912 mm—ensures the Aeon makes an undeniable statement, pushing the boundaries of traditional PC aesthetics.

The Aeon’s Captivating Opening Mechanism

True to its ‘Signature Chassis’ lineage, the InWin Aeon doesn’t just look unique; it engages. Accessing its interior involves one of the most elaborate and intriguing opening mechanisms ever seen in a PC enclosure. Users initiate the process by swiping an RFID card across the case’s base, a gesture that feels straight out of a sci-fi film. Following this, a sophisticated hydraulic system gracefully opens and lowers the back panel to a flat position. While meticulously designed for seamless hardware installation, this intricate ballet of technology also highlights the engineering complexity that defines such exclusive products, a characteristic that both fascinates and adds to its allure.

Internal Versatility and Optimal Cooling

Beyond its eccentric and captivating exterior, the Aeon chassis offers robust internal hardware support, demonstrating that form can indeed meet function. It thoughtfully accommodates a wide array of motherboards, from E-ATX down to Mini-ITX. Builders will appreciate the eight PCIe expansion slots, ample space for GPUs up to 360 mm in length, and CPU heatsinks with a maximum height of 140 mm. For thermal management, the InWin Aeon provides exceptional flexibility, supporting multiple fans up to 140 mm or radiators in both 360 mm and 420 mm configurations, ensuring superior cooling performance essential for today’s high-performance gaming PCs and workstations.

InWin’s Legacy of Visionary Designs

While InWin showcased more conventional desktop housing options at CES 2026, it’s their commitment to pushing the boundaries of design that truly sets them apart. Beyond the Aeon, InWin is celebrated for its consistently unconventional and digital innovation-driven approach to PC aesthetics. Their portfolio includes previously unveiled origami-inspired PC cases, 3D-printed chassis, and even a whimsical magical coffee cup design. This enduring dedication ensures InWin remains a pioneer in blending art with cutting-edge hardware design.

CES 2026: A Showcase of PC Case Innovation

Beyond InWin’s striking creations, CES 2026 also spotlighted other groundbreaking PC case designs that promise to redefine gaming PC aesthetics and functionality. Thermaltake introduced a sophisticated Mini-ITX PC case born from a unique collaboration with French artist Koralie, blending technology with artistic expression. CyberPower PC unveiled an elegant mid-tower offering, distinguished by dedicated knobs for intuitive color adjustments, a testament to user-centric design. Furthermore, Asus’s new ROG G1000 gaming PC captured significant attention with its “world’s first” fan-based holographic system, integrated directly into the case. These innovations collectively showcase the dynamic and evolving landscape of PC hardware, offering tech enthusiasts exciting possibilities for future builds.
